Groovy Documentation

org.codehaus.groovy.grails.resolve.maven.aether.config
[Groovy] Class DependencyConfiguration

java.lang.Object
  org.codehaus.groovy.grails.resolve.maven.aether.config.DependencyConfiguration

@groovy.transform.CompileStatic
class DependencyConfiguration

Used to configure an individual dependency

Authors:
Graeme Rocher
Since:
2.3


Field Summary
static java.lang.String WILD_CARD

 
Property Summary
org.eclipse.aether.graph.Dependency dependency

boolean exported

 
Constructor Summary
DependencyConfiguration(org.eclipse.aether.graph.Dependency dependency)

 
Method Summary
void exclude(java.util.Map exc)

void exclude(java.lang.String name)

void exclude(org.eclipse.aether.graph.Exclusion exclusion)

void excludes(java.lang.Object... excludes)

protected java.util.List getExclusionList()

boolean getTransitive()

void propertyMissing(java.lang.String name, java.lang.Object value)

void setChanging(boolean b)

void setExport(boolean e)

void setOtional(boolean b)

void setScope(java.lang.String s)

void setTransitive(boolean transitive)

 
Methods inherited from class java.lang.Object
java.lang.Object#wait(long, int), java.lang.Object#wait(long), java.lang.Object#wait(), java.lang.Object#equals(java.lang.Object), java.lang.Object#toString(), java.lang.Object#hashCode(), java.lang.Object#getClass(), java.lang.Object#notify(), java.lang.Object#notifyAll()
 

Field Detail

WILD_CARD

public static final java.lang.String WILD_CARD


 
Property Detail

dependency

@groovy.lang.Delegate
org.eclipse.aether.graph.Dependency dependency


exported

boolean exported


 
Constructor Detail

DependencyConfiguration

DependencyConfiguration(org.eclipse.aether.graph.Dependency dependency)


 
Method Detail

exclude

void exclude(java.util.Map exc)


exclude

void exclude(java.lang.String name)


exclude

void exclude(org.eclipse.aether.graph.Exclusion exclusion)


excludes

void excludes(java.lang.Object... excludes)


getExclusionList

protected java.util.List getExclusionList()


getTransitive

boolean getTransitive()


propertyMissing

@groovy.transform.CompileStatic(TypeCheckingMode.SKIP)
void propertyMissing(java.lang.String name, java.lang.Object value)


setChanging

void setChanging(boolean b)


setExport

void setExport(boolean e)


setOtional

void setOtional(boolean b)


setScope

void setScope(java.lang.String s)


setTransitive

void setTransitive(boolean transitive)


 

Groovy Documentation